How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Campobello?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Campobello Studio Apartments | $1,299 | $1,249 | $1,349 |
Campobello 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,215 | $860 | $1,675 |
Campobello 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,446 | $895 | $3,555 |
Campobello 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,629 | $1,100 | $2,025 |
Campobello 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,712 | $1,200 | $2,404 |
